Output e1c6685b361635554f1bafd26dd482f7cc6fa0e537dae23707d22b36bceef51b:86

value
376690
script pubkey
OP_0 OP_PUSHBYTES_20 de8f5a2b5996bcb92af66dc8db5762b58e7e19ee
address
bc1qm684526ej67tj2hkdhydk4mzkk88ux0wnn52ll
transaction
e1c6685b361635554f1bafd26dd482f7cc6fa0e537dae23707d22b36bceef51b